Analysis

In 2024, chemical wood pulp — import value in Uzbekistan stood at 61,124 1000 USD. That is the highest value across all 27 years on record.

That represents a change of up 61.8% on the previous year and up 2,526.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, chemical wood pulp — import value in Uzbekistan peaked at 61,124 1000 USD in 2024 and was at its lowest, 114 1000 USD, in 2005.

Uzbekistan ranks 55th of 199 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
